出 处:《消防科学与技术》2009年第3期189-192,共4页Fire Science and Technology
摘 要:介绍了低压二氧化碳灭火系统的构成及工作原理,详述了影响低压二氧化碳灭火系统可靠运行的三个主要控制参数:制冷系统的启动和停止、高低压力报警、高低液位报警,在比较了目前使用的低压二氧化碳灭火系统的控制元件后,对应用范围最广、最能精确控制上述三个参数的1151电容式差压变送器的工作原理以及如何控制低压二氧化碳贮存装置压力和液位方面进行了详细说明,为低压二氧化碳灭火系统的设计提供了参考。Low pressure carbon dioxide fire extinguishing systems are developed based on the theory of high pressure carbon dioxide fire extinguishing systems, and it has been widely applied in several kinds of fire protection areas. This paper introduces the composing and working theory, describes three main control parameters which influence the running reliability of low pressure carbon dioxide fire extinguishing systems, such as startup and stop of refrigeration system, high and low pressure alarm and high and low liquid level alarm. After comparing the control elements used in low pressure carbon dioxide fire extinguishing at present, the paper detailedly explains the working theory of 1511 capacitance type differential pressure transmitter which can accurately control the above-mentioned parameters and how to control pressure and liquid level of low pressure carbon dioxide fire extinguishing systems. It provides the reference for designing low pressure carbon dioxide fire extinguishing systems.
关 键 词:低压二氧化碳灭火系统 电容式差压变送器 压力 液位
